Tommy Paul has reached his maiden ATP 500 final at the Mexican Open in Acapulco, by beating World No. 5 Taylor Fritz 6-3, 6-7 (2), 7-6 (2) in the semifinals.The match was a thrilling encounter and lasted for three hours and 25 minutes, which is the longest in the history of the Mexican Open. It has surpassed last year's fixture between Grigor Dimitrov and Stefan Kozlov, which went on for three hours and 22 minutes.Tommy Paul and Taylor Fritz were tested physically throughout the match, and by the end both players were cramping. Tennis fans, however, had mixed reactions to the contest. De Minaur reached his third ATP 500 final by beating Holger Rune 3-6, 7-5, 6-2 in the semifinals.Paul and De Minaur will lock horns for the fourth time, with the latter leading 3-0 in the head-to-head. All of their previous meetings came last season, with their last encounter being in the quarterfinals of the Rothesay International in Eastbourne. De Minaur won that match 6-2, 4-6, 6-4.Victory for Paul will see him win his second ATP singles title, while De Minaur will win his seventh if he comes out on top.
